About F.J. Evans
F.J. Evans is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Statistical and Nonlinear Physics,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Molecular Biology, having authored 66 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Control and Stability of Dynamical Systems (7 papers), Quantum chaos and dynamical systems (5 papers),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(5 papers),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(4 papers), Cardiac pacing and defibrillation studies (4 papers), Stability and Control of Uncertain Systems (4 papers), Advanced Thermodynamics and Statistical Mechanics (4 papers) and Power System Optimization and Stability (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(986 citations), Nephrology (58 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(165 citations), Epidemiology (210 citations) and Control and Systems Engineering (158 citations). F.J. Evans has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include M. Ribbens-Pavella, Robert S. Balaban, Stephanie French, Elliot R. McVeigh, Owen Faris, Catherine M Otto, Nalini M. Rajamannan, Elena Aïkawa, Craig A. Simmons and Kevin D. O’Brien. Their work appears in journals such as Electronics Letters, Automatica, Journal of the Franklin Institute, International Journal of Control and IEEE Transactions on Instrumentation and Measurement.
